Custom Mouthguards

Custom Sports Mouthguard

Custom Sports Mouthguard

Custom mouthguards are a device worn over the teeth that can serve numerous purposes. Many people wear a mouthguard to protect their teeth during athletics. You may also wear a custom mouthguard as a treatment for TMJ/TMD, sleep apnea or to protect your teeth from grinding (bruxism). There are many types of mouth guards that can be purchased in drugstores and sporting goods stores. But there are many advantages to having a mouthguard custom-made by a dentist.

Why Choose a Custom Mouthguard over Store-bought?

A dentist can help you make sure a mouthguard  is the right treatment for you and that the fit is correct and won’t cause joint, muscle or teeth problems. Most of the mouthguards you purchase in a store are fit to your teeth after softening the plastic in hot water and then biting into the material as it cools. Often this results in very poor fit. This poor adaptation to your teeth can make the mouthguard uncomfortable to wear and ineffective. Custom mouthguards will fit precisely over your teeth and stay in during sports or while you are sleeping. Most patients report that they find store-bought mouthguards uncomfortable and bulky in comparison to a custom-made device.

How is a Custom Mouthguard Made?

At your appointment, impressions of your teeth will be taken so that we can create a model of your teeth. This model is then used to custom form the mouthguard material. Either at the same time or a separate appointment (depending on the type of mouthgard), the mouthguard is fitted to your teeth and adjusted so that your other teeth can rest comfortably against it.

How Long Do They Last?

Custom mouthguards are very durable. They only require simple cleaning and can last for years.
